Anonymous wrote:> I'll be wanting 240v not that pansy 110v!

The power is in the amperage and I believe the Yanks 110 volts may be stronger in that regard.
Not correct I'm afraid. Power (watts), in general terms, is the product of voltage and current (amps). For the same power with half the voltage you would need double the current.

500 watts in the US is the same as 500 watts anywhere else in the world.
